Basically, it is a NoSQL database to store the unstructured data in document format. AWS EC2 - Elasticsearch Installation on the Cloud Would you like to learn how to install Elasticsearch on a computer running Ubuntu Linux on the Amazon AWS cloud? The following examples demonstrate Create, Read, Update and Delete operations on a deployments resource.. You have your EC2 Role. One of the most challenging tasks in any microservices ecosystem is the centralized log management, and there are many open source and paid solutions available in the market. curl -XDELETE localhost:9200/_all In order to avoid losing all of your data, you can just iterate over all of your indexes and delete them that way. I understand why you're doing that, but I think the Principal requires a USER, not a role. In Elasticsearch, every index consists of multiple shards and every shard in your elasticsearch cluster contributes to the usage of your cpu, memory, file descriptors etc. aws_elasticsearch_domain provides the following Timeouts configuration options: update - (Optional, Default: 60m) How long to wait for updates. As for an example with time series data, you would write and read a lot to an index with ie the current date. Also, I think you have an issue with the "Principal" in your access policy. How to Install Elasticsearch 6 on CentOS 7 with Kibana Data Visualization tool One details is that I chose an non-VPC ElasticSearch cluster. Following tutorial will … Compiled plugins for Elasticsearch 2.3.4 and 2.4 can be found at this repository. Discussion Forums > Category: AWS Web Site & Resources > Forum: PHP Development > Thread: Elasticsearch credentials timeout. In the previous article Running Elasticsearch on AWS we configured a three-node Elasticsearch cluster on AWS EC2. Lucene is the full-functional information retrieval library API written in java. How to Install Elasticsearch 6.x on Ubuntu 18.04 LTS (Bionic Beaver) Linux. 4) Create AWS ElasticSearch cluster. Import. Share this blog. Now, AWS offers you AWS Elasticsearch managed service, that would help you in operating, deploying, and scaling, Elasticsearch in AWS … CURL and Elasticsearch April 2, 2019 - by Michael Wutzke If you want to connect to Elasticsearch from the Linux command line, you can do that with CURL, for example. Install npm install aws-es-curl -g Prequisities. How to Install Elasticsearch 5.x on Ubuntu 18.04 LTS (Bionic Beaver) Linux. Search Forum : Advanced search options: Elasticsearch credentials timeout Posted by: mhugot. Just got stuck with backing up the Elasticsearch index backup. – Josh Edwards May 11 '17 at 8:00. Concourse CI/CD devops prometheus kubernetes monitoring modbus kepware c-programming IoT golang telegram bot python cli urwid elasticsearch aws ecs apache spark scala AWS EMR hadoop webhooks ssl nginx digital-ocean emr apache pig datapipeline found.io elastic-cloud rails try capybara docker capistrano heka bigquery kafka protobuf vim iterm javascript emberjs git scripting … Listing your deploymentsedit. Maybe on a normal elastic search instance you do it your way I can't say! AWS Elasticsearch Service makes it really easy to stand up an elasticsearch cluster fronted by Kibana. This definitely helps for performance in parallel processing. → Elasticsearch uses Lucene internally to build its state of art distributed searching and analytics capabilities. instead of uploading the file you paste the jason into the kibana interface! In this tutorial, we are going to show you how to create a new account at Amazon AWS, how to create an Ubuntu virtual machine instance, and how to perform the Elasticsearch installation on a new virtual machine on the … Suppose our elasticsearch is running at localhost and at port 9200. Elasticsearch Cluster with AWS Spot Instances. Elastic search commands: The below command will print out all of your indexes that contain 'aws… Elasticsearch API cheatsheet for developers with copy and paste example for the most useful APIs We need to perform one-time setup to associate the S3 bucket with the ES cluster, and configure the appropriate IAM Role. Under this Elastic search command blog, you will be knowing a few key commands such as the creation of an index, the listing of all indices, Curl methods, retrieve and delete of data indices. Elasticsearch provides a Create Index API to manually create index by sending PUT request. Improve this question. ElasticSearch is sometimes complicated. It is used for the analytic purpose and searching your logs and data in general. The Snapshot & Restore functionality will help you back up you indices with different strategies. The Elasticsearch default communication port is 9300/tcp (not to be confused with the HTTP interface running on port 9200/tcp by default). (This article is part of our ElasticSearch Guide.Use the right-hand menu to navigate.) aws-es-curl. It can behave unexpectedly and either vomit gigabytes in your logs, or stay desperately silent. We’ve created a pull request to bump the aws sdk for Elasticsearch 5 here. Here we show some of the most common ElasticSearch commands using curl. It was fairly straightforward and didn't take much time or effort. Posted on: Nov 5, 2018 2:19 AM : Reply: elasticsearch, php, timeout, credentials. I’ve been using it since 0.11 and deployed every version since 0.17.6 in production. Elasticsearch is an open-source database tool that can be easily deployed and operated. Simple curl-like utility with V4 request signing support for AWS Elasticsearch Service.. Share. AWS, DevOps, Technology; 11 / Nov / 2016 by Neeraj Gupta 1 comments. Well actually it was, that is how you upload an index to the aws elasticsearch service. In our ecosystem, we are using ELK stack as it provides scalability and the … List the details about all of your Elasticsearch … The only option I see is to delete the domain, am I missing something? We will need to setup three VM’s with Cent OS 7.x version and configure network interfaces so that they are available in the network and can communicate with each … → Elasticsearch is a document storage thing like MongoDB. What is AWS Elasticsearch. Manual snapshots. Now, Elasticsearch is an open-source search and analytics engine, that could be used to store, search and analyze, huge volumes of data quickly or in near real-time. Let’s see how to create an index in elasticsearch with different configuration, Create an Index in Elasticsearch with default shards, replicas. Thanks for your help! Elasticsearch domains can be imported using the domain_name, e.g. In addition, we conducted performance benchmarking using Rally as the benchmarking tool comparing Arm-powered Amazon EC2 M6g … Its documents look in field like JSON and we access them over HTTP(so we can use curl). Follow the prompts in the AWS console. Become a Elasticsearch Certified professional by learning Elasticsearch online course from hkrtrainings! amazon-web-services elasticsearch. 1. The indices we needed to restore were around 2 – 3 TB in size. Provision an Elasticsearch Cluster ... A built-in user database, which makes it easy to configure usernames and passwords inside of Elasticsearch. Not much to say here. This allows users to deploy Elasticsearch on Arm Neoverse powered AWS Graviton2 instances. However, I must admit it’s sometimes a pain in the ass to manage. These contain the bumped version of aws … 4 min read. ES backup and restore using AWS S3 We were fortunate enough to get an opportunity to do an Elasticsearch cluster snapshot and restore on a production highly active cluster. This is the first article of a series that covers Elasticsearch index Backup. It does not offer in the UI (neither AWS console nor Kibana UI) is the ability to manage the retention of storage. In this post we will only cover the ELK deployment however the Cent OS VM deployment and network configuration of VM is not covered here. Follow asked Aug 6 … A patchfile to update the aws sdk for older versions can be found here. I setup an AWS Elasticsearch Domain recently but I didn't see a way to stop it (like you can with an EC2 instance), which means I'm continuously billed. One of those strange behaviour can happen after one or more data nodes are restarted. I realize this isn't exactly what you want, but start off with this (open to the world), curl from outside AWS and test it. At this stage I just need to do some testing and don't require a full-time cluster. Using Curl command : This will demonstrate how simple it is to … Make sure your Elasticsearch domain is configured with access policy template "Allow or deny access to one or more AWS … $ terraform import aws_elasticsearch_domain.example domain_name. The communication port can be changed in the Elasticsearch configuration file ( elasticsearch. This question is answered. How to Deploy a three-node Elasticsearch Cluster on Ubuntu 18.04. Our task was to take a snapshot from an old cluster (v 6.4.2) which had several huge indices and… Regarding this, what port does Elasticsearch use? We will expand on the Running Elasticsearch on AWS example and configure Beats to feed the Elasticsearch cluster running on AWS EC2 instances. By default, elasticsearch will consume data until it runs out of space. AWS Identity and Access Management (IAM) integration, which lets you map IAM principals to permissions. Then restrict it, that way you're able to isolate the issues. Elasticsearch is one of my favorite piece of software. If you us an IAM policy to protect your domain and restrict it to a particular AWS account, wouldn't the index/search requests to that domain have to be signed with credentials from that account? Simple curl-like utility with request signing support for AWS ElasticSearch Service - jenseng/aws-es-curl Hello, i work on a website using elasticsearch and … Elasticsearch on AWS. yml ) with the configuration setting transport.. One may also ask, how do I connect to AWS Elasticsearch? For the initial Access Policy for the ES cluster, I chose an IP-based policy and specified the source CIDR blocks allowed to connect: So here we make it simple. The VM’s can be hosted on-premise or any hyperscalers such AWS, Azure or GCP . In this blog, we show Elasticsearch analytics use case for Twitter data analysis on a cluster of AWS Graviton2 based Amazon EC2 M6g instances.
Mabel's New Hero,
Baghdad Meaning In Urdu,
See You Artinya,
Juárez Metro Population,
Monsterland Episodes Explained,
Devon Cycle Routes Map,
Dla Piper Nz,
Elephant Rhymes For Preschoolers,
Backstage Season 1,
British Things Horrible Histories,
Antoine Parfums Elle,